[算法 内部排序]冒泡排序

来源:互联网 发布:首创证券软件 编辑:程序博客网 时间:2024/05/18 01:52

/* 冒泡排序 */

void BubbleSort(int a[],int n)
{
  int temp,k;

  for(int i=0;i<n;i++)
  {
    k=0; //监视哨
    for(int j=0;j<n-i-1;j++)
    {
      if(a[j]>a[j+1])
      {
         temp=a[j];
         a[j]=a[j+1];
         a[j+1]=temp;
         k=1;
      }
    }
    //没有交换
    if(k==0) break;
  }

}

原创粉丝点击